Statistical inference. This course aims to show students the methods which make it possible to estimate the features of a population, or taking a decision regarding a population, based solely on the results obtained from a sample. When exercising any current profession, Statistical inference is a tool which provides valuable information, optimising resources in order to obtain it, as this information is taken from samples when there is a restriction on obtaining information via a census of the population in question.System Theory (OCW Polytechnic University of Valencia)
